The Homes
As far as standalone villa communities in Dubai are concerned, Jumeirah Park is one of the largest. There are over 3,000 villas in total, available in a choice of Mediterranean-inspired architectural styles with three to five-bedroom layouts. Additionally, there is a cluster of 137 contemporary townhouses known as Jumeirah Park Homes that is under development.
The villas range in size from roughly 4,000 sq ft to 5,500 sq ft, sitting on large plots that can measure as much as nearly 11,000 sq ft in size. If you have a growing family that needs plenty of space, this community is a great option.


There are four different styles of villas in Jumeirah Park, some of which offer two types of layouts. There is the Small layout, which has a built-up area of 3,063 sq ft, and the Large layout, which is 3,527 sq ft and adds in an upstairs family room.
Heritage
The Heritage style is inspired by the traditional architecture of the Emirates, giving it a modern spin with full-height windows and wide open living spaces. It features three-bedroom Large villas.
Legacy
The Legacy villas have a Mediterranean style design that comprises terracotta roofs and mosaic tiled interior elements, given a contemporary twist. They are available in three-bedroom (Small and Large), four-bedroom and five-bedroom layouts.


Legacy Nova
Much like the Legacy villas, Legacy Nova features a Mediterranean-inspired design with some contemporary elements, such as a window above the foyer area to let in plenty of light. These villas are only available in 4-bedroom layouts.
Regional
The Regional villas primarily have a Middle Eastern design influence, but add in elements of European and contemporary design to create something wholly unique. They offer three to five-bedroom layouts, with the three-beds having a Small or Large option.
Jumeirah Park Homes
Jumeirah Park Homes, the newest addition to Jumeirah Park is made up of 137 four-bedroom townhouses with a gorgeous contemporary design style.

The Lifestyle
The homes at Jumeirah Park offer plenty of garden and yard space, but even beyond that, there are parks, playgrounds and landscaped walking trails that lend the community a unique character. It is a perfect space for families, whether it is a young couple starting a new chapter of our life, or a larger family looking for a long-term primary residence.


The Jumeirah Park Pavilion offers retail outlets, restaurants, cafes, supermarkets and a variety of essential services. It has recently expanded to add a few more outlets as well. Coming up later this year is the Clubhouse, which will become the main recreational centre of the community. The Clubhouse will feature an Olympic-sized swimming pool, a state-of-the-art fitness centre, a nursery, a signature restaurant, and more. Residents can also head over to the neighbouring Jumeirah Islands Club, where they will enjoy fantastic facilities in a waterfront setting.
The community also has its own school - the Dubai British School - which provides a complete academic program from kindergarten through to high school. This also makes it very attractive for families, who don’t need to worry about their children’s educational needs in the slightest, knowing that they are in good hands. Connectivity
The community of Jumeirah Park benefits from a quiet location that provides seamless road connections to some of Dubai’s best schools and hospitals. Emirates International School at The Meadows, Arcadia School, Al Furjan British School, and others are just a few minutes’ drive away, as are several nurseries. In terms of healthcare, you have Mediclinic, Medicentres, HMS Clinic, Aster Clinic, among others. Right next door, you have two vibrant waterfront communities - Jumeirah Islands and Jumeirah Lakes Towers. Both of them offer plenty of options for dining, recreation, fitness and leisure.
This community also enjoys easy access to Sheikh Zayed Road and to Mohammed bin Zayed Road, two major highways of the city, which in turn allows for easy commutes to other major districts. Dubai Marina, one of the city’s most famous leisure and entertainment destinations, is only a 10-minute drive away, and the beach is just a little bit further than that. Two championship golf clubs - Emirates Golf Club and the Address Montgomerie - are only 15 minutes away, and other key destinations such as Downtown Dubai and two international airports are less than half an hour away.
